Understanding Heat Pump Technology for Chicago Heights Homes
Heat pumps represent one of the most efficient heating and cooling solutions available for residential properties in Chicago Heights, IL. Unlike traditional heating systems that generate heat through combustion or electrical resistance, heat pumps transfer existing heat from one location to another, making them remarkably energy efficient even during harsh Midwest winters. This technology works by extracting heat from outdoor air, ground, or water sources and transferring it inside during winter months, then reversing the process to provide cooling during summer.
The physics behind heat pump operation relies on refrigerant cycles and the principle that heat naturally flows from warmer to cooler spaces. Even when outdoor temperatures drop below freezing, modern heat pumps can extract ambient heat from the air and concentrate it for indoor heating. Types of Heat Pump Systems We Install
Air-source heat pumps remain the most popular choice for Chicago Heights homeowners due to their relatively simple installation and lower upfront costs. These systems extract heat from outdoor air and can efficiently heat homes even when temperatures drop to -5°F, though efficiency decreases as temperatures fall. Modern cold-climate air-source heat pumps feature enhanced components specifically designed for northern climates, including improved defrost cycles and backup heating elements for extreme cold snaps.
Ground-source or geothermal heat pumps offer the highest efficiency levels by tapping into the stable temperatures found underground. While requiring more extensive installation involving buried loop systems, geothermal heat pumps provide consistent performance regardless of outdoor air temperature. Ductless mini-split heat pumps present another excellent option, particularly for homes without existing ductwork or for adding climate control to specific zones. These systems allow precise temperature control in individual rooms while maintaining high efficiency ratings.
Professional Installation and Sizing Considerations
Proper heat pump sizing requires detailed load calculations considering your home’s square footage, insulation levels, window efficiency, and local climate data. Undersized systems struggle to maintain comfortable temperatures during extreme weather, while oversized units cycle on and off frequently, reducing efficiency and comfort while increasing wear. Maintenance Requirements and Service Support
Regular maintenance keeps heat pump systems operating at peak efficiency and extends equipment lifespan. Essential maintenance tasks include:
- Filter replacement: Clean filters ensure proper airflow and system efficiency
- Coil cleaning: Both indoor and outdoor coils require periodic cleaning to maintain heat transfer efficiency
- Refrigerant level checks: Proper refrigerant charge is critical for optimal performance
- Electrical component inspection: Connections and controls need regular evaluation for safety and reliability
- Defrost cycle verification: Ensuring proper defrost operation prevents ice buildup during winter months

Cost Considerations and Energy Savings
Initial heat pump installation costs vary based on system type, capacity, and installation complexity. While upfront investments typically exceed those of traditional heating systems, long-term energy savings often offset higher initial costs within several years. Federal tax credits and utility rebates frequently apply to qualifying heat pump installations, reducing net costs for homeowners. Current federal incentives can cover up to 30% of installation costs for qualifying high-efficiency systems.
Operating cost comparisons demonstrate significant savings versus traditional heating methods. Heat pumps typically reduce heating costs by 30-60% compared to electric resistance heating and can compete favorably with natural gas heating, especially as gas prices fluctuate. During cooling season, heat pumps match or exceed the efficiency of high-performance air conditioners while providing the added benefit of dehumidification.
